What this exclusion type means

HHS-OIG identifies exclusion type 1128a4 as “Felony conviction relating to controlled substance.” Felony conviction relating to a controlled substance (mandatory exclusion, minimum 5 years).

This exclusion type is a statutory category used by HHS-OIG in the LEIE dataset. The category describes the legal authority associated with the exclusion record, not a separate investigation or additional reporting by Excluded Provider.
